2024/12月 读书笔记 - 9《构建之法》--- 第九章

在项目管理领域,不同公司对于项目管理角色的称呼有所不同。以下是几种常见的项目管理角色:
Product Manager (PM):产品经理,负责确保产品正确地开发和实现。
Project Manager (PM):项目经理,负责确保项目流程正确地执行。
Program Manager:在微软,这个职位指的是负责特定项目或程序的经理。
微软项目经理(Program Manager)的由来
微软的项目经理被称为Program Manager,这与传统的Project Manager有所不同。微软最初是一个由程序员创立的创业公司,创始人和早期员工大多是开发人员。查尔斯·西蒙尼,一位杰出的程序员,于1981年加入微软,并试图推行MP(Manager of People)和SP(Manager of Stuff)的改革,以减少沟通成本。但由于没有人愿意担任SP角色,这次改革最终未能成功。
后来,贾伯·布鲁门萨尔提出了Program Manager(PM)这一职位,并成为微软的第一位PM。PM的引入使得负责特定功能的开发/测试人员能够与PM紧密合作,而PM则代表团队与其他小组或客户进行沟通,显著降低了沟通成本。PM负责处理开发/测试之外的事务,进行项目管理,让开发人员能够专注于技术工作。实践证明,这种改革是利大于弊的。
PM的职责与特点
PM在项目中扮演着至关重要的角色,他们负责带领团队实现目标,并保持团队的平衡。在牛人主导的项目中,项目可能会经历大起大落,而在PM主导的项目中,“不犯大错”成为了一个显著特点。
PM的能力要求和任务
观察、理解和快速学习能力:PM需要能够快速理解项目需求和团队动态。
分析管理能力:PM需要具备强大的分析和项目管理技能,以确保项目按计划进行。
一定的专业能力:PM应具备一定的技术或业务专业知识,以便更好地理解项目需求。
自省的能力:PM需要能够自我反思,从经验中学习,不断改进项目管理方法。

posted @   Moonbeamsc  阅读(6)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 【自荐】一款简洁、开源的在线白板工具 Drawnix
· 没有Manus邀请码?试试免邀请码的MGX或者开源的OpenManus吧
· 无需6万激活码!GitHub神秘组织3小时极速复刻Manus,手把手教你使用OpenManus搭建本
· C#/.NET/.NET Core优秀项目和框架2025年2月简报
· DeepSeek在M芯片Mac上本地化部署
返回顶端
点击右上角即可分享
微信分享提示